In Switzerland, exclusive education and boarding schools are synonymous with academic excellence, refined traditions, and an unmatched environment for personal growth. These institutions are designed not just as places of learning, but as transformative spaces where students are immersed in a holistic blend of rigorous academics, cultural diversity, leadership opportunities, and ethical development. The very nature of these schools is defined by their selective admissions, tailored curricula, and strong emphasis on cultivating multilingual, globally minded individuals poised to take on leadership roles in the future.
What truly sets these Swiss schools apart is a deep-rooted commitment to nurturing the next generation of leaders. From early morning classes to after-hours clubs, every detail is calibrated to foster independence, critical thinking, and responsibility. Students are exposed to a rich array of international perspectives, facilitated by world-class faculty, and set against the stunning backdrops of the Swiss Alps or serene lakesides. Alongside academic prowess, personal growth and leadership training are interwoven into daily routines, ensuring each graduate steps confidently onto the world stage.
These exclusive Swiss schools consistently rank among the world’s finest thanks to their demanding academic programs and extensive extracurricular offerings. Unlike many national school systems, their international accreditations ensure students are well-equipped for elite universities worldwide. For instance, Le Rosey is renowned for producing influential alumni in fields ranging from diplomacy to the arts. Such networks open doors for future collaborations and leadership roles beyond school walls.
Another defining advantage is the multi-lingual education offered by most Swiss boarding schools. Students typically navigate courses in English, French, or German, promoting adaptability and communication skills prized in global leadership. The multicultural student communities mirror the diplomatic character of Switzerland itself—imparting real-world experience in cross-cultural dialogue and collaboration.
The value of location cannot be understated. Institute Auf dem Rosenberg, nestled near St. Gallen, and Aiglon College, perched on a mountain overlooking Lake Geneva, use Switzerland’s stunning natural landscape as an extended classroom. This setting not only supports health and wellbeing but also inspires stewardship, reflection, and resilience—key traits for leaders in a swiftly changing world.
Even within Switzerland’s circle of exclusivity, each of these schools has unique features that shape future leaders differently. From Le Rosey’s renowned international seminars to TASIS’s American-style innovation, every campus has a distinct approach to unlocking student promise. The deeper details reveal even more valuable insights ahead…